Why Fencing and Decking Should Be Planned Together

Many homeowners install a fence first and only think about a deck later. By that stage the materials, colours, and layout have already been decided, which can make it difficult to create a unified design.

Planning both elements together allows you to consider how the deck connects to the yard, where privacy is needed, how views are framed, and how colours and materials work together.

This integrated approach creates a space that feels cohesive rather than pieced together over time.

Creating Visual Flow with Coordinated Colour Palettes

One of the easiest ways to achieve a cohesive outdoor design is through coordinated colours and materials.

Rather than trying to match materials perfectly, the goal is to create a palette that works together.

For example:

  • Light decking boards paired with white fencing
  • Warm timber tones matched with neutral boundary fencing
  • Dark charcoal decks complemented by modern grey fencing

Modern PVC fencing and composite decking systems make this coordination much easier because colours are manufactured with precision and remain consistent over time.

Unlike timber, which weathers unpredictably, engineered materials maintain their intended appearance year after year.

A Simple Planning Checklist for Homeowners

If you’re considering both fencing and decking, it helps to plan the space as a whole before construction begins.

A few early design decisions can make a big difference.

Planning your outdoor space

  • Decide where privacy is most important
  • Consider how the deck connects to the house and garden
  • Choose colours that work together across materials
  • Plan gates, pathways, and access points
  • Think about how the space will be used for entertaining or relaxing
  • Coordinate installation timing if both elements are being installed

Taking time to think through these details early helps ensure the finished space feels balanced and functional.
